A. Anyone who lives and pays taxes in Manitoba and graduated from an eligible post-secondary institution anywhere in the world on or after January 1, 2007 is eligible for the rebate on tuition paid on or after January 1st, 2004.
A. Eligible institutions are those recognized by the Canada Revenue Agency (CRA). This includes public and private universities, colleges and other educational institutions.
A. If the school you attended is recognized by the Canada Revenue Agency (CRA), you will be eligible for the rebate.
A. You must complete the form `T1005 Manitoba Tuition Fee Income Tax Rebate' of your income tax return. See www.cra.gc.ca
A. The lifetime maximum benefit claim is $25,000.
A. No, the Tuition Fee Income Tax Rebate is non-transferable.
A. You must make your first claim within 10 years of graduating. Depending on the amount of Manitoba income tax that you owe, the benefit will be applied over the next six to twenty years.
For example:
Graduated 2007
Total tuition paid - $14,000
Maximum claimable under the Tuition Fee
Income Tax Rebate is $14,000 X 60% = $8,400
Year One
Tuition Rebate is the lesser of:
1. 10% of your tuition = $1,400
2. Annual maximum = $2,500
3. Manitoba tax payable = $600
Remaining claimable tuition is
$8,400 - $600 = $7,800
Year Two
Tuition Rebate is the lesser of:
1. 10% of tuition= $1,400
2. Annual maximum = $2,500
3. Manitoba tax payable = $2,400
Remaining claimable tuition is
$7,800 - $1,400 = $6,400
Years Three to Seven
Assuming Manitoba tax payable remains above $1,400 into the future, a tuition rebate will be available for a total of seven years.
A. You are entitled to claim a rebate for all tuition paid within a 20 year period beginning with your first claim up to the lifetime maximum benefit of $25,000.
A. You may need to provide proof of tuition paid or graduation. Documentation may include the Canada Revenue Agency slip `T2202A Tuition, Education, and Textbook Amounts Certificate', your degree, diploma or certificate.
A. If you no longer live in Manitoba, you are not entitled to receive benefits under this tuition rebate program. However, if you return to Manitoba within 10 years of graduating you are still entitled to make a claim.
